Output 71e300e12cad52883cefadfff3b04488c6229707bac42264779166a348343386:1601

value
10578839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1bd43188d52c93c5d935a99dcb694fa5febb3f OP_EQUAL
address
MEkJFQGcFGC1oYjkBiaQv8N1s8nUNfKbq9
transaction
71e300e12cad52883cefadfff3b04488c6229707bac42264779166a348343386
spent
true